The variety has a mid-late maturity group. The bush is developed, with dense foliage and an upright stem position. Tubers are oval in shape, possessing yellow skin and flesh color.
The plant possesses pronounced resistance to viruses, including PVY and leaf roll virus, as well as to necrotic strains of PVY. It exhibits resistance to late blight on leaves, is moderately resistant to tuber infection, and is resistant to potato wart.
The variety was obtained through selection by crossing parental forms BOBR and SCHWALBE. Due to its resistance to viral diseases, the variety is of value for the production of seed material.
